Bug Description

Konqueror resets the position to the top of the current page while loading a new page.
This behaviour is confusing as it seems that the new page has already been loaded.

This is a KDE 3.5.6 regression:
http://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=140768

The fix for the bug has already been posted there.

yaztromo (tromo) wrote :

This bug also increase page loading times considerably. Hoping for a fix before feisty final!

"SVN commit 628618 by savernik:

Reverting r617941. This fixes jumping to the top right before loading a
new page and also fixes page loading time increase."
